Hazard Identification

To ensure the safety of mountain climbers, it is crucial to conduct thorough hazard identification before embarking on any climbing expedition. Risk assessment is an essential step in this process, as it allows climbers to identify potential hazards and develop appropriate safety protocols.

Risk assessment involves evaluating the likelihood and severity of various hazards, such as loose rocks, unstable terrain, inclement weather conditions, or avalanches. By assessing these risks, climbers can make informed decisions about the level of danger they are willing to accept and implement necessary precautions.

Safety protocols, including the use of protective gear, adherence to climbing techniques, and regular communication with a base camp or support team, are vital for minimizing risks and ensuring the well-being of climbers.

Avalanche Awareness

An essential aspect of mountain climbing safety is having a thorough understanding of avalanche awareness. When venturing into mountain terrain, climbers must be aware of the potential risks posed by avalanches.

Avalanches occur when a mass of snow slides down a slope, often triggered by factors such as weather conditions, slope steepness, and snowpack stability. To mitigate the risks, climbers must assess the snow conditions carefully. Factors such as recent snowfall, wind patterns, temperature fluctuations, and the presence of weak layers within the snowpack can significantly increase the likelihood of an avalanche.

Additionally, climbers should be familiar with avalanche terrain features, such as steep slopes, gullies, and areas prone to wind-loading, as these areas are more susceptible to avalanche activity. By being aware of avalanche dynamics and understanding the indicators of unstable snowpack, climbers can make informed decisions regarding their route selection and minimize the risk of encountering an avalanche.

Weather Precautions

How can climbers ensure their safety by taking appropriate weather precautions during mountain climbing expeditions? When venturing into the mountains, it is crucial to stay informed about the weather conditions to mitigate potential risks. Here are some key weather precautions that climbers should consider:

  • Weather monitoring: Stay updated on the weather forecast before and during the climb. Pay attention to changes in temperature, wind speed, and precipitation patterns, as these can significantly impact climbing conditions.

  • Emergency shelters: Always carry emergency shelters such as bivouac sacks or lightweight tents. These can provide protection in case of unexpected weather changes or emergencies.

  • Layering: Dress in layers to adapt to fluctuating weather conditions. This allows for easy adjustment to temperature changes and provides insulation against cold or extreme heat.

  • Wind protection: Use wind-resistant clothing and gear to protect yourself from the effects of strong winds, which can be particularly dangerous in exposed areas.

  • Visibility: Be mindful of low visibility caused by fog, snow, or rain. In such conditions, rely on navigational aids such as compasses, maps, and GPS devices to maintain a sense of direction.

Knot Tying

One essential skill for climbers to master is the proper tying of knots. Knot tying is crucial for rope management and ensuring the safety of climbers during their ascent.

There are various knots that climbers should be familiar with, each serving a specific purpose. The figure-eight knot, for example, is commonly used to secure the climber's harness to the rope. It is easy to tie and untie, making it ideal for quick and efficient movements.

The double fisherman's knot, on the other hand, is used for joining two ropes together, providing strength and reliability. Other knots, such as the clove hitch and the prusik knot, are essential for climbing techniques like belaying and ascending.

Mastering these knots is essential for climbers to navigate the challenges of the mountain safely and effectively.

Continuing from the previous subtopic, climbers must possess proficient navigation skills to ensure their safety and success while scaling mountains. When it comes to mountain climbing, having a solid understanding of compass use and map reading is essential. Here are five key points to consider:

  • Familiarize yourself with different types of compasses and their features to choose the right one for your expedition.
  • Learn how to properly orient a map using a compass, aligning it with the surrounding landscape for accurate navigation.
  • Understand the various symbols, contour lines, and scales used on maps to interpret terrain features and plan routes effectively.
  • Practice using a compass to take bearings, measure distances, and navigate through challenging terrain, such as dense forests or steep slopes.
  • Develop the ability to navigate in low visibility conditions, such as fog or darkness, by using compass bearings and relying on other sensory cues.

Essential Gear for Safety

To ensure the highest level of safety while mountain climbing, it is imperative to consistently and meticulously select the appropriate gear. Proper gear selection not only enhances performance but also plays a critical role in minimizing risks and emergencies.

Here are five essential gear items that climbers should prioritize:

  • Climbing helmet: Protects the head from falling rocks or accidental impacts.

  • Harness and ropes: Vital for securing oneself to the mountain and preventing falls.

  • Carabiners and quickdraws: Essential for attaching ropes to anchors and protection points.

  • Climbing shoes: Provide grip and support on different terrains.

  • Communication devices: Including radios, satellite phones, or personal locator beacons, these enable climbers to stay connected and call for help in case of emergencies.

Regular gear maintenance, such as checking for wear and tear, ensures that equipment remains reliable and functional. Additionally, knowing how to effectively use emergency communication devices is crucial for prompt assistance during critical situations.

Importance of Proper Fit

Proper gear selection is of utmost importance in mountain climbing, as it ensures not only optimal performance but also minimizes risks and emergencies.

One crucial aspect of gear selection is proper sizing. Ill-fitting gear can significantly compromise a climber's safety and comfort. Equipment that is too large or too small can impede movement, cause discomfort, and increase the risk of accidents. It is essential to carefully consider the sizing charts provided by manufacturers and seek expert advice if needed.

Additionally, equipment compatibility is another vital factor to consider. Mountaineers should ensure that their gear, such as harnesses, helmets, and footwear, works seamlessly together, allowing for efficient movement and maximum protection.

Proper fit and equipment compatibility enable climbers to navigate challenging terrains with confidence, reducing the likelihood of accidents or injuries.

Altitude Sickness Prevention

How can climbers prevent altitude sickness while mountain climbing?

Altitude sickness, also known as acute mountain sickness (AMS), can be a serious condition that affects individuals ascending to high altitudes too quickly. To prevent altitude sickness, climbers should utilize acclimatization techniques and be familiar with symptoms recognition.

Acclimatization is the process by which the body adjusts to changes in altitude. This can be achieved through gradual ascent to higher altitudes, allowing the body time to adapt to the decrease in oxygen levels. Climbers should start with shorter climbs at lower altitudes, gradually increasing their elevation over time.

Recognizing the symptoms of altitude sickness is crucial for prevention. Symptoms may include headache, nausea, dizziness, fatigue, and difficulty sleeping. If any of these symptoms occur, it is important to descend to a lower altitude as soon as possible.
